Форум 1С
Программистам, бухгалтерам, администраторам, пользователям
Задай вопрос - получи решение проблемы
23 ноя 2024, 01:04

Передать значение в другую форму

Автор spirit1086, 02 окт 2013, 23:32

0 Пользователей и 1 гость просматривают эту тему.

spirit1086

Посматрите решил так работает как мне надо, логически правильно сделал?

   Процедура ТАБПОЛЕБанковскиеСчетаПередНачаломДобавления(Элемент, Отказ, Копирование, Родитель, ЭтоГруппа)
   // Вставить содержимое обработчика.
   
   МояФорма = Справочники.БанковскиеСчета.ПолучитьФорму("ФормаЭлемента");
           МояФорма.ЭлементыФормы.Организация.Значение = ЭлементыФормы.Наименование.Значение;
           МояФорма.Открыть();

     // МояФорма.ЭлементыФормы.Организация.Значение  - Это реквизит Формы2
     //  ЭлементыФормы.Наименование.Значение;  - Это реквизит Формы1 который надо передать в форму2

   КонецПроцедуры


chuevsf

А если Значение убрать?
МояФорма.Организация = Наименование;

И еще... ВЫ уверены, что слева и справа одинакового типа значения?

spirit1086

Цитата: chuevsf от 03 окт 2013, 15:07
А если Значение убрать?
МояФорма.Организация = Наименование;

И еще... ВЫ уверены, что слева и справа одинакового типа значения?
Слева тип произвольный, справа строка, проверил работает

chuevsf


spirit1086


chuevsf

Цитата: spirit1086 от 03 окт 2013, 15:39
да!:zebzdr:

А СПАСИБО значит уже говорить и не надо вовсе....:dfbbdrfb:

spirit1086


chuevsf

Цитата: spirit1086 от 03 окт 2013, 20:39
спс))
Вообще-то слева есть кнопка "Сказать СПАСИБО", если вам действительно помогли.

Теги:

Похожие темы (5)

Рейтинг@Mail.ru

Поиск